HC Deb 11 July 1967 vol 750 cc396-7
11. Mr. Hector Hughes

asked the Minister of Technology if he will make a statement indicating the effective development of technology in Scotland, the organisation and increase of staff in the Industrial Liaison Centre established at Aberdeen, the scope of its work and the industries affected by it and its plans for the future.

Mr. Dell

Action by the Ministry of Technology is contributing to the technological development of Scottish industry across a very broad front. The future of the Industrial Liaison Centre at Aberdeen is under discussion with the Scottish Education Department. My right hon. Friend is not yet able to make a statement.

Mr. Hughes

Is not one of the aims of the Industrial Liaison Centre to increase trade, industry and commerce in Scotland? If so, will my hon. Friend specify what his plans are in that direction?

Mr. Dell

Certainly one of the objects of the Centre is to assist industry in Scotland. What we are considering is the future staffing and financing of the Centre. The Government are doing a great deal about technological development in Scottish industry, a recent example being the foundation of the Institute of Machine Tool Design.

Mr. Lawson

Is my hon. Friend aware that a number of my hon. Friends recently saw some of the work being done by his Ministry in Scotland and were very much impressed? May we press him to continue to develop that work?

Mr. Dell

I am very grateful for my hon. Friend's remarks. We have had a number of very important successes—for example, with the low-cost automation clinics al Paisley and Edinburgh.
